Title: The Innovative Contributions of Daesoo Kim in Lithium Battery Technology

Introduction: Daesoo Kim, a prominent inventor based in Daejeon, South Korea, has made significant contributions to the field of lithium battery technology. With a remarkable portfolio of eight patents, his innovations focus on enhancing the performance and sustainability of lithium battery cells.

Latest Patents: Two of Daesoo Kim's latest patents showcase his expertise in recovering and manufacturing lithium battery cells. The first patent, titled "Method for recovering lithium battery cell by heat treatment," details a novel method for reviving degenerated lithium battery cells, subjecting them to a high-temperature treatment process in a fully discharged state. This process significantly improves the battery's performance and longevity. The second patent, titled "Manufacturing method of lithium secondary battery comprising additional heat-treatment process," outlines an advanced method for manufacturing lithium secondary batteries that incorporate a heat-treatment process to enhance their efficiency and effectiveness.
